We are a provider of specialized fund administration services for Managers and General Partners of private equity funds, specifically: Buy‐out, Venture Capital, Real Estate and Fund‐of‐Funds. For new General Partners, we provide consulting services to help accelerate the launch of their funds in addition to our full fund administration services. For established General Partners, we provide administration services and technology to whole fund families or select funds, to help scale their fund operations rapidly and efficiently.
JOB DESCRIPTION:
The Engagement Manager at Standish is responsible for managing and leading all client engagements. In conjunction with the Engagement Director, the Engagement Manager is responsible for supervising the Fund Controller and Associate in matters of fund accounting, capital account maintenance and financial statement preparation.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
- Maintain frequent client contact to keep abreast of ongoing fund activities
- Manage client expectations
- Manage engagement keeping in mind client needs, staff utilization and overall engagement efficiency
- Supervise the audit and tax preparation process
- Review all communications to the client and its investors on an ongoing basis
- Assist with sourcing new clients, issuing proposals and overall business development
- Mentor and train junior staff members
M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S:
- Bachelor's Degree required (Finance/Accounting/Economics concentration preferred)
- 2+ years of public accounting experience or equivalent
- 2+ years of VC/PE fund experience or fund administrator – OR – minimum 1 year as manager at a public accounting firm
- Previous Private Equity/VC experience and knowledge of Partnership Accounting, preferred
- CPA preferred
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ications, particularly Excel, Word & Outlook
- Familiarity with QuickBooks preferred
